Title
Approval of Budget Ordinance Amendment No. 26BCC054 for a Transfer of $167,418 from the General Government Functional Area to the Economic and Physical Development Functional Area for a Mid-Year FTE Reallocation
Body
Date of BOCC Meeting: February 9, 2026
Request for Board Action:
Agenda Text
The Board is requested to approve Budget Ordinance Amendment No. 26BCC054 for a Transfer of $167,418 from the General Government Functional Area to the Economic and Physical Development Functional Area for a Mid-Year FTE Reallocation. In FY 2025-26, one FTE within the County Manager's Equitable Well-Being team was reallocated to create a Manager for Special Projects position within the Cooperative Extension department. The Manager for Special Projects position was created to assist with increased administrative workload and building out special initiatives due to an increase in scope and project load within the department. Funding for this position is being transferred to Cooperative Extension to cover salary and benefits for the newly created position, as well as operating dollars to assist with travel and training, contract initiatives, food and provisions, and office build out.
